Walked in on a Saturday at lunch time, which would be the busiest time, however although extremely busy, my girlfriend and I were acknowledged straight away and were kept informed about potential tables by the extremely friendly and attentive staff.

The menu had fantastic choices to cater to all preferences, I had the matcha coconut latte which was tasty, and an open breakfast wrap, which was like nothing else I’ve ever had brunch wise, packed full of colour and flavour.

My girlfriend had the brunch burger which was extremely filling and again so flavoursome. The ambience was chilled, stylish but not pretentious and Hamid, one of the owners made it his aim, despite being rushed off his feet, to personally ensure that each and every customer was happy with their experience. Looking forward to going back to making my way down the rest of the menu!

User

Really don’t understand what all the fuss is about, unless the instagram-able pancakes truly are the only good thing about this place?? Average priced ‘full english’ breakfast for Leigh but extremely poor value especially when not done properly. We requested the homemade beans when ordering, both came with Heinz and when replaced, were served lukewarm. The one single piece of bacon was around an inch wide and 6 inches long, overdone and hard, one small piece of toast provided - for which you had to ask for separate butter for, which was served cold and therefore rock hard, which might have been ok if the toast was warm enough to melt it - and the ‘poached’ egg was clearly cooked in one of those shallow frying pans with moulded circles. The ‘hash brown’ was about as thin as a pound coin, again very small and completely fell apart when trying to cut it as it was just simply grated sweet potato mushed together. I cannot understand why you would open an eatery specifically based around breakfast food and not be able to get the basics right.
